These Chocolate Almond Cookies with a hint of cayenne are the perfect treat for anyone who loves a little surprise in their sweets. The base is rich with almond butter, which brings a nutty depth and a wonderfully soft, chewy texture. Coconut sugar adds gentle sweetness while keeping the flavor balanced and not overly sugary.
Cocoa powder and chocolate chips team up to give these cookies a deep, indulgent chocolate flavor that feels both comforting and just a bit sophisticated. The addition of a small pinch of cayenne pepper is what makes them special — it adds a subtle warmth that complements the chocolate without overpowering it.
Baked until just set, the cookies come out tender on the inside with slightly crisp edges. A sprinkle of flaky sea salt on top enhances the chocolate and highlights the gentle heat from the cayenne.
These cookies are as fun to make as they are to eat, perfect for when you want to elevate your usual chocolate cookie routine with something unexpected yet irresistible.
